  • Abstract
    Quite effective nature of isocyanides to control the curing reaction of silicone resin via the Ptcatalyzed hydrosilylation process is described. In the presence of the isocuanides, the curing reaction of the silicone resin by H2PtCl6 did not occur at ambient temperature, while the lack of the isocyanide systems conducts the smooth curing, indicating that the present systems serve as a thermal latent catalyst for silicone resin. The curing temperature was controllable by the character and the concentration of the isocyanides employed.
